maturin is most commonly pronounced "mat uh rin" (/ˈmætʊrɪn/). This is the widely-used reading among engineers, though edge cases exist.
STRESS first syllable: MAT-uh-rin (short 'a' as in 'mat', NOT ma-TUR-in). PyO3's official CLI to build & publish Rust-based Python wheels (used by polars, pydantic-core, etc.; pip-installable). The README doesn't document a pronunciation, but 'Maturin' is a real French Huguenot given name (cf. Stephen Maturin in O'Brian's Aubrey–Maturin novels), and references consistently put the stress on the FIRST syllable. A yod variant 'MAT-yuh-rin' also occurs.
Alternate readings you might hear:
/ˈmætjʊrɪn/Source: PyO3/maturin — official GitHub repo (formerly pyo3-pack)
